Wikileek

Combine:
1 leek, sliced
1 large potato, cubed
1/2 scary little red pepper, chopped fine
1/2 c milk
Microwave for 3 minutes 33 seconds
Add:
4 oz cream cheese (1/2 brick)
1/2 bunch wilted arugula (because you're never going to actually use it in a salad)
1/2 t salt
1 t dried parsley
black pepper
Microwave for 2 minutes
Add:
3 eggs
1/2 c grated cheddar
Bake in a flat ceramic dish at 350 for 40 minutes or until a knife inserted comes out clean.

Really yummy, but I might have used too much potato.
